Focus on The Things You Can Control
β
One of the most important things I have learned in my adult life is how to focus on the things you can control.
β
You canβt control what happens to you, but you can control how you respond to what happens to you.
β
The latter is the key to becoming successful, especially when it comes to your money.
β
As a wealth builder, we must focus on what we can control. If you focus on the things that happen to you outside of your control, you will never get ahead.
β
A massive example is the environment you are born in.
Unfortunately, privilege is real.
β
If you are born into a bad situation, youβve been dealt cards that you have no control over.
β
You have two options: allow your environment to become who you are, or learn from the mistakes in your environment and work on getting out of that situation.
β
Your response to the bad things in your life will save you.
β
You go into debt because a car broke down.
β
You can blame the lemon of a car and the manufacturer, or you can make sure that it never happens again by saving cash.
β
You bought a stock and it goes to zero.
β
You can blame the market, or decide Iβm going to learn how the rich get wealthy in a safe way.
β
Your spouse has tens of thousands of dollars in student loans.
β
You can blame them for their decisions, or help them develop a plan that will get your family out of debt.
β
Your response will dictate your outcome in life. It is worth its weight in gold to learn how to respond accordingly to life.
